This Position reports to: Product Engineering Manager As a member of the Product Engineering Team, you will help drive improvements in Electrification Distribution Solutions (ELDS) in Pinetops, North Carolina. The Associate Electrical Product Engineer for LV & MV instrument transformer products provides technical support related to the development and production of LV & MV IT products, including their accessories and various hardware. The role also includes estimating production costs and designing to meet special customer requirements. The work model for the role is: onsite (Li-Onsite) This role is contributing to the Electrification Distribution Solutions division in Pinetops, NC. You will be mainly accountable for: Analyze and evaluate all aspects of the LV & MV IT product line, including manufacturing processes, individual components, application requirements, and special customer requirements. Manufacturing processes include: general assembly, resin casting, copper & metal forming, and all aspects of product testing. Work directly with testing and manufacturing associates to fully understand internal manufacturing processes to ensure employee safety, improve quality, and reduce lead times and costs. Create, review and maintain production specifications such as BOM’s, production instructions, and testing requirements. Work directly with sales, product management, quality, and design engineering to address customer concerns, identify potential product improvements, participate in design reviews, and launch new products in manufacturing. Implement design changes using CAD software and GD&T techniques.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ree in electrical or mechanical engineering or a degree in a related field plus 1 or more years of electro-mechanical design / manufacturing experience.
  • Familiar with the design of electro-mechanical components and the selection, specification, and testing of conductive and insulating materials.
  • Ability to effectively use the following computer applications: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int, SolidWorks, AutoCAD preferred.
  • Candidates must already have a work authorization that would permit them to work for ABB in the US.
